Understanding the Bench Press Movement
Before diving into the specifics of bench pressing without rack, it is crucial to understand the basic movement. The bench press involves lying on a flat bench, gripping the barbell with both hands, and pressing it upwards until your arms are fully extended. Once the barbell is overhead, you lower it back down to your chest before repeating the movement. This exercise requires proper form and technique to prevent injuries and maximize results.
